AMELANCHIER ALNIFOLIA 'ISSAC'
The Isaac Saskatoon Berry (Amelanchier alnifolia) is a compact, high-yielding shrub that thrives in various soil conditions, making it ideal for small spaces and diverse climates. The Isaac variety ripens early in July, offering a sweet almond-like flavor perfect for fresh eating, jams, and desserts. This plant is partially self-fertile, making it easy to grow, and is resistant to common diseases. Its ornamental value is enhanced by early spring blooms and attractive bronze foliage throughout the growing season.

| Colour | White flowers; blue‑purple fruit |
| Hardiness Zone | 2 - 9 |
| Height | 98" |
| Sun Requirements | Full Sun |
| Fragrant | No |
| Deer Resistant | Yes |
| Plant Timing | March - April |
| Harvest | Late June-July |
| Plant Depth | Crown at soil level |
| Spacing | 40" |
| Pollinating | Self Pollinating |
| Other | High in Vitamin C, Iron, and Calcium. Eat fresh or as a preserve |
